Dustin Martin is a Financial Advisor who joined Raymond James in March of 2019 after five years with Fidelity Investments. As a Workplace Planning Consultant, he built retirement plans with clients that focused on strategic tax planning and optimization of their employer benefits. Dustin understands that when choosing a financial advisor, one of the primary factors to consider is experience. As a member of a team with over 150 years of combined experience, he brings a different perspective to the financial challenges and milestones that today's clients face. Dustin believes that a comprehensive financial plan is something that evolves over time and your financial advisor should be able to guide you through it both now and for years to come.
Dustin is a Certified Financial Planner® professional. He has taken the extra step to demonstrate his professionalism by submitting to the rigorous CFP® certification process that includes demanding education, examination, experience and ethical requirements. He also obtained his Certified Exit Planning Advisor (CEPA®) designation after completing the Exit Planning Institute's intensive 5-day executive MBA-style program. The Certified Exit Planning Advisor program was specifically designed for business advisors who work closely with owners of privately held companies and is the most widely accepted and endorsed professional exit planning program in the world.
He is a graduate of the University of Cincinnati, where he received a Bachelors in Business Administration and majored in finance.
